OBINNA Igboebisi, who contested the May 29, NDC primary election for Idemili North Constituency, Anambra assembly, said that he was optimistic that the NDC national assembly/election panel would affirm his victory in that election.

The London-based industrialist, who divides his time between Nigeria and London, told journalists in Obosi that the video footages of the election would convince the NDC leadership/election panel that he won the election.

“I am the darling of NDC members in Idemili North; I am their favourite politician. 

“And they expressed their love for me on the day of the primary election by standing behind me. 

“The spectacle which is captured on video is an irrefutable proof that I am their chosen candidate,” Igboebisi said.

Also, he thanked his NDC supporters, who braved the odds and came out en masse to vote for him.

“I remain appreciative and thankful to you for coming out to vote for me in spite of all odds.

“It is your expressions of love for me. And your kind gestures are not lost on me,” Igboebisi quipped. 

The NDC primary election for Idemili North Constituency, Anambra state assembly took place on May 29, 2026 at Ogidi civic centre, Anambra state. 

The election pitted Hon. Igboebisi against his town’s man, Hon. Emma Nwobosi, who is one of the sons of the Biafra war hero, Col. Emma. Nwobosi snr. 

The winner of the Idemili North Constituency, Anambra state assembly election, which was imperfect, as no human systems of doing things are perfect, will be determined by NDC election panel/leadership in the coming days.
